Make sure your home has quality locks on all the windows and the doors. Windows must have locks to keep burglars out, and they should have burglar-proof glass. Your doors should either be made of metal or solid wood. They should have heavy-duty, reinforced strike plates. The best locks to have for them are either knob-in-lock sets with dead latches or deadbolts.

Be sure you have secured your attached garage. Many people are concerned about people entering their garages to gain access to their homes. You can use a C-clamp to secure the door and prevent it from being opened by strangers.
